Andy Thompson pointed out the aircooled VWs did it that way - and so did every other car until … WebYes, an exhaust fan from the garage to outdoors will lower the pressure in the garage. A sufficiently sized fan designed and installed by a qualified contractor will prevent CO from entering the house and speed the removal of CO from the garage.

WebExhaust air from bathrooms and toilet rooms shall not discharge into an attic, crawl space, or other areas of the building. In simple terms, it is against the code to vent exhaust air from the bathroom and toilet rooms to any other room in the house, and that includes the garage. Web6 de ago. de 2024 · Radiant heat can be addressed using a radiant barrier, spray foam, or active attic ventilation. We have found that a combination of all three is typical for most attics. Some attics are difficult to move in or have unique architectural challenges that may require all three options to help reduce radiant heat in the attic.
